#!/usr/bin/env python
|
|
"""
|
|
Test script for the 3-step avatar upload process.
|
|
This script will:
|
|
1. Request an upload URL
|
|
2. Upload an image to Cloudflare
|
|
3. Save the avatar reference
|
|
"""
|
|
|
|
import requests
|
|
|
|
# Configuration
|
|
BASE_URL = "http://127.0.0.1:8000"
|
|
API_BASE = f"{BASE_URL}/api/v1"
|
|
|
|
# You'll need to get these from your browser's developer tools or login endpoint
|
|
ACCESS_TOKEN = "your_jwt_token_here" # Replace with actual token
|
|
REFRESH_TOKEN = "your_refresh_token_here" # Replace with actual token
|
|
|
|
# Headers for authenticated requests
|
|
HEADERS = {
|
|
"Authorization": f"Bearer {ACCESS_TOKEN}",
|
|
"Content-Type": "application/json",
|
|
}
|
|
|
|
|
|
def step1_get_upload_url():
|
|
"""Step 1: Get upload URL from django-cloudflareimages-toolkit"""
|
|
print("Step 1: Requesting upload URL...")
|
|
|
|
url = f"{API_BASE}/cloudflare-images/api/upload-url/"
|
|
data = {
|
|
"metadata": {
|
|
"type": "avatar",
|
|
"userId": "7627" # Replace with your user ID
|
|
},
|
|
"require_signed_urls": False
|
|
}
|
|
|
|
response = requests.post(url, json=data, headers=HEADERS)
|
|
print(f"Status: {response.status_code}")
|
|
print(f"Response: {response.json()}")
|
|
|
|
if response.status_code == 201:
|
|
result = response.json()
|
|
return result["upload_url"], result["cloudflare_id"]
|
|
else:
|
|
raise Exception(f"Failed to get upload URL: {response.text}")
|
|
|
|
|
|
def step2_upload_image(upload_url):
|
|
"""Step 2: Upload image directly to Cloudflare"""
|
|
print("\nStep 2: Uploading image to Cloudflare...")
|
|
|
|
# Create a simple test image (1x1 pixel PNG)
|
|
# This is a minimal valid PNG file
|
|
png_data = b'\x89PNG\r\n\x1a\n\x00\x00\x00\rIHDR\x00\x00\x00\x01\x00\x00\x00\x01\x08\x02\x00\x00\x00\x90wS\xde\x00\x00\x00\tpHYs\x00\x00\x0b\x13\x00\x00\x0b\x13\x01\x00\x9a\x9c\x18\x00\x00\x00\x12IDATx\x9cc```bPPP\x00\x02\xd2\x00\x00\x00\x05\x00\x01\r\n-\xdb\x00\x00\x00\x00IEND\xaeB`\x82'
|
|
|
|
files = {
|
|
'file': ('test_avatar.png', png_data, 'image/png')
|
|
}
|
|
|
|
# Upload to Cloudflare (no auth headers needed for direct upload)
|
|
response = requests.post(upload_url, files=files)
|
|
print(f"Status: {response.status_code}")
|
|
print(f"Response: {response.json()}")
|
|
|
|
if response.status_code in [200, 201]:
|
|
return response.json()
|
|
else:
|
|
raise Exception(f"Failed to upload image: {response.text}")
|
|
|
|
|
|
def step3_save_avatar(cloudflare_id):
|
|
"""Step 3: Save avatar reference in our system"""
|
|
print("\nStep 3: Saving avatar reference...")
|
|
|
|
url = f"{API_BASE}/accounts/profile/avatar/save/"
|
|
data = {
|
|
"cloudflare_image_id": cloudflare_id
|
|
}
|
|
|
|
response = requests.post(url, json=data, headers=HEADERS)
|
|
print(f"Status: {response.status_code}")
|
|
print(f"Response: {response.json()}")
|
|
|
|
if response.status_code == 200:
|
|
return response.json()
|
|
else:
|
|
raise Exception(f"Failed to save avatar: {response.text}")
|
|
|
|
|
|
def main():
|
|
"""Run the complete 3-step process"""
|
|
try:
|
|
# Step 1: Get upload URL
|
|
upload_url, cloudflare_id = step1_get_upload_url()
|
|
|
|
# Step 2: Upload image
|
|
upload_result = step2_upload_image(upload_url)
|
|
|
|
# Step 3: Save avatar reference
|
|
save_result = step3_save_avatar(cloudflare_id)
|
|
|
|
print("\n✅ Success! Avatar upload completed.")
|
|
print(f"Avatar URL: {save_result.get('avatar_url')}")
|
|
|
|
except Exception as e:
|
|
print(f"\n❌ Error: {e}")
|
|
|
|
|
|
if __name__ == "__main__":
|
|
print("🚀 Testing 3-step avatar upload process...")
|
|
print("⚠️ Make sure to update ACCESS_TOKEN in the script!")
|
|
print()
|
|
|
|
if ACCESS_TOKEN == "your_jwt_token_here":
|
|
print("❌ Please update ACCESS_TOKEN in the script first!")
|
|
print("You can get it from:")
|
|
print("1. Browser developer tools after logging in")
|
|
print("2. Or use the login endpoint to get a token")
|
|
exit(1)
|
|
|
|
main()
